I could really use some help right about now.

well that looks like the proper mount. you sure the motor is sitting in there properly? maybe the drivers side is low? is that a new mount there? the rubber looks old. if its old it could be sagging. you can get the magnum mount from schumacher for like $35. all you need is the rubber part.